Netflix Orders Comedy Series Starring Kristen Bell From Erin Foster, Steven Levitan

Joe Otterson TV Reporter Netflix has picked up a new comedy series starring Kristen Bell from writer Erin Foster and executive producer Steven Levitan, Variety has learned. The untitled series is said to center on “the unlikely relationship between an irreverent, outspoken, agnostic woman and an unconventional rabbi.” Bell is set to play one of the lead roles, though exactly which is being kept under wraps. Foster created the series and serves as an executive producer. Bell also executive produces in addition to starring. Levitan executive produces via Steven Levitan Productions (SLP). Craig DiGregorio, Sara Foster, and Danielle Stokdyk also executive produce. Oly Obst and Josh Lieberman are executive producers for 3 Arts. 20th Television will produce in association with SLP, with the company currently under an overall deal at the studio.

‘Waco: The Aftermath’: Showtime Reveals First Look and Premiere Date for Limited Series (TV News Roundup)

Charna Flam Showtime’s upcoming series, “Waco: The Aftermath,” will debut on the streaming service and on-demand April 14, followed by its linear premiere on April 16 at 10 p.m. A first-look image has been released in addition to the premiere date (see above). “Waco: The Aftermath” follows the 2018 limited series “Waco,” which retold the true story of the 51-day standoff between a small religious community and the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ives (ATF). “The Aftermath” stars Michael Shannon, who reprises his role as Gary Noesner, a FBI hostage negotiator suffering from PTSD after the failed negotiations in Waco. Shannon is rejoined by John Leguizamo as Jacob Vasquez, an undercover ATF agent. The upcoming five-episode series will document the fallout of the disaster, including the trials of the surviving Branch Davidian members and the rise of homegrown terrorist Timothy McVeigh.

How the ‘Winnie the Pooh: Blood and Honey’ Composer Played a Beehive to Score the Slasher

Jazz Tangcay Artisans Editor “Winnie the Pooh: Blood and Honey” composer Andrew Scott Bell used a wealth of unique sounds, including a beehiveolin — a combination of a beehive and violin — to score the micro-budget slasher movie. Bell recalled reading an article in The New Yorker about Tyler Thackray, the creator of Instagram account @violintorture, who experiments with violins by altering them. Once, he even placed a beehive inside a violin to see if the bees would populate it. This would become the integral instrument Bell used in the film’s score. Bell wanted to track down the instrument, or at least try. He explains, “I emailed him and said, ‘I’m doing this movie. It’s wacky and fun. I think it would be crazy to use that violin, do you still have it?’”

‘The White Lotus’ No Longer Eligible for Emmys’ Limited Series Category, Moving to Drama (EXCLUSIVE)

Emily Longeretta The limited series category is saying goodbye to Tanya and Co. at the 2023 Emmy Awards. The TV Academy is no longer allowing HBO’s “The White Lotus” in the limited/anthology category and Variety has confirmed that the series will move to the drama category. Season 1, starring Jennifer Coolidge, Murray Bartlett, Connie Britton and Sydney Sweeney, earned 10 Emmy Awards. The second season brought back Coolidge as her Season 1 character — new cast members included Aubrey Plaza, Meghann Fahy, Theo James and Michael Imperioli. In 2021, the Television Academy defined what a limited or anthology series is, explaining that the story must be resolved within its season, with no ongoing storylines allowed.
